Rapid Buildup in High-Traffic Zones
Problem
Entrances, hallways, and shared spaces act as magnets for dirt, moisture, and germs. In office buildings or retail spaces, these areas can accumulate debris 3x faster than other zones, creating slip hazards and unprofessional impressions.
Solution
Start with preventative measures: install anti-microbial entrance mats to trap 80% of outdoor dirt. Pair this with a tiered cleaning schedule, spot-clean floors, and wipe high-touch surfaces (door handles, elevator buttons) 2–3 times daily. For deep cleaning, use pH-neutral detergents weekly to preserve floor finishes.
Pro Tip: To maintain a polished appearance, rotate cleaning times to target peak traffic periods, such as after lunch breaks or after client meetings.
Stubborn Carpet Stains and Odors
Problem
Spills from coffee, ink, or food can seep into carpets, leaving unsightly marks and lingering odors. Over time, embedded dirt breaks down carpet fibres, shortening their lifespan and impacting indoor air quality.
Solution
Act fast blot spills immediately with microfiber cloths to prevent absorption. For older stains, professional hot-water extraction cleans deep into fibres without harsh scrubbing. Complement this with carpet protectants, which create an invisible barrier against future spills.
Pro Tip: Schedule bi-annual steam cleaning for high-traffic carpets. This not only removes allergens but also revives colors, making your workspace look brand-new.
Inefficient Waste Management Systems
Problem
Overflowing bins, mismatched recycling, and food waste left overnight attract pests and create foul odors. In shared spaces like coworking hubs or medical offices, poor waste management can even violate health codes.
Solution
Implement a color-coded three-bin system (recycling, compost, landfill) with clear visual labels. Schedule waste pickups during off-peak hours to avoid disrupting workflows. To combat smells in kitchens or break rooms, use odor-neutralizing tablets or charcoal filters in bins.
Pro Tip: Educate employees on proper disposal practices through quick training sessions or signage this reduces contamination and boosts recycling rates.
Restroom Hygiene Risks
Problem
Restrooms are breeding grounds for bacteria like E. coli and norovirus, especially in high-occupancy buildings. Damp surfaces, inadequate ventilation, and infrequent cleaning escalate health risks and employee complaints.
Solution
Upgrade to touchless fixtures, motion-sensor soap dispensers, auto-flush toilets, and hands-free hand dryers to minimize cross-contamination. Stock restrooms with hospital-grade disinfectants and odor-neutralizing sprays. For thorough sanitization, deep-clean grout lines, faucets, and drains daily.

Dust Accumulation in Hard-to-Reach Areas
Problem
Dust clings to ceiling vents, light fixtures, and electronics, triggering allergies and reducing HVAC efficiency. In open-plan offices or warehouses, these neglected areas become reservoirs for airborne particles.
Solution
Use telescopic dusters with microfiber heads to clean vents and high shelves. For electronics, opt for anti-static wipes to avoid damage. Integrate HEPA filter vacuums into your routine to capture 99.97% of particles as small as 0.3 microns.
Pro Tip: Seal gaps around windows and doors to minimize outdoor dust infiltration, especially during Vancouver’s rainy seasons.
Floor Maintenance Without Disruptions
Problem
Buffing, waxing, or stripping floors during business hours halts productivity and risks accidents. In retail or hospitality settings, closed-off areas can frustrate customers and stall sales.
Solution
Schedule intensive floor care after hours or on weekends. Use quick-dry finishes that cure in under an hour, minimizing downtime. For daily upkeep, adopt a “clean-as-you-go” policy with microfiber mops and lightweight cordless scrubbers.
Pro Tip: Place “Wet Floor” signs in multiple languages to accommodate diverse workplaces and reduce liability.
Inconsistent Cleaning Quality
Problem
High staff turnover or inadequate training can lead to missed opportunities, uneven results, and frustrated employees. In industries like healthcare or food service, inconsistent cleaning can even jeopardize safety.
Solution
Develop visual checklists with photo examples for each task (e.g., “properly sanitized desk” vs. “surface wiped”). Conduct monthly training refreshers on new tools or protocols. Hire certified professionals for specialized tasks like window washing or biohazard cleanup.
Pro Tip: Use a digital inspection app to track cleaning performance in real time and address gaps immediately.
Meeting Eco-Conscious Demands
Problem
Employees and clients increasingly prioritize sustainability, but many businesses still rely on chemical-heavy cleaners that harm the environment.
Solution
Transition to Green Seal or EcoLogo-certified products, which are non-toxic and biodegradable. Replace disposable wipes with reusable microfiber cloths, and invest in equipment like low-water floor scrubbers. Share your eco-initiatives in newsletters or social media to align with client values.
Pro Tip: Conduct a “green audit” annually to identify new ways to reduce waste, like switching to refillable soap dispensers.

FAQs
How often should office kitchens be deep-cleaned?
Daily wipe-downs (countertops, appliances) are essential, but to prevent grease buildup and mold, schedule weekly deep cleans for sinks, microwaves, and cabinets.
Are eco-friendly products effective against tough stains?
Modern green cleaners use plant-based enzymes and oxygen bleach to tackle even oil and wine stains without toxic fumes.
What’s the most overlooked cleaning task in offices?
HVAC vents. Dirty ducts recirculate dust and allergens. Clean them annually to improve air quality and system efficiency.
